Bob Reiser is an author, playwright, and screenwriter. He lives in Easthampton, Massachusetts.
Legendary folksinger and peace advocate Pete Seeger (1919―2014) issued approximately one hundred records and wrote or worked on dozens of books, and collaborated on numerous radical songbooks and articles.
